Exchange Methods Adopted during the Vedic Period | India | History

In the earliest period of the history of human culture, all exchange was by barter i.e., the exchange of one article for another. This was the stage of simple barter. Aryans and their Agricultural Developments | Vedic Period | Indian History

Agriculture was the principal occupation in the villages. Its adoption took place undoubtedly at a very early age, though we have nothing, which can tell us as to the period when it was adopted. History of Aryans: Labour and Occupations | Vedic Period | Indian History

In this article we will discuss about the occupations and condition of labour during Aryans period. The ever-increasing wants of society gave rise to different crafts. The requirements of agriculture, of war and of religion gave a stimulus to these craftsmen. Sections of the community began to engage themselves in these occupations.
